      Well, after the cricket season has ended and club rugby has begun so one wonders what has happened to last years BOP team ?

      From the BOPRU website here is a list of last years players.

      Aidon Ross :- Playing for the Chiefs

      Ajay Mua :- Currently injured but still about.

      Bailey Simonsson :- Contracted to The NZ sevens team and playing in Hong Kong soon.

      Chase Tiatia :- On the fringes of the Hurricanes but is not playing locally so unsure where he is.

      Cullum Retallick :- Not playing but is Assistant Coach to Tauranga Sports.

      Elijah Nicholas :- Playing locally for Rangiuru having shifted from Te Puna.

      Henry Stowers :- Gone back to Wellington.

      Hugh Blake :- Don't know.

      Asaac Te Aute :- Playing locally for Rangiuru having shifted from the Mount.

      James Lay :- Was playing for Bristol over the summer.

      James O'Reilly :- Playing for the Hurricanes.

      Jeff Thwaites :- Playing for the Chiefs.

      Jessi Parette :- Don't know.

      Joe Webber :- Contracted to The NZ Sevens team and playing in The Com. Games soon..

      Jordan Lay :- Playing for Edinburgh over the summer.

      Keepa Mewett :- Playing in Japan.

      Kelly Haimona :- Playing for Wakarewarewa. Incidentally can anyone confirm that he is a half brother to Clayton McMillon ?

      Lalakai Foketi :- Playing for The Waratahs.

      Liam Polwart :- Playing for the Chiefs.

      Liam Steel :- Don't know.

      Luke Campbell :- Playing for Te Puke Sports.

      Mike Delany :- Playing for the Crusaders.

      Mitchel Karpik :- Playing for the Chiefs.

      Monty Ioane :- Playing in France and contracted there for another couple of years.

      Richard Judd :- Playing for the Hurricanes.

      Seb Siataga :- Playing locally for Rotoiti after moving from the Mount.

      Siegried Fisi'ihoi :- Playing in France.

      Solomona Sakalia :- Don't know.

      Terrence Hepetema :- Playing for the Highlanders.

      Tom Fanklin :- Playing for the Highlanders.

      Troy Callander :- Playing in Japan.

      Tyler Ardron :- Playing for the Chiefs.

      As usual there is plenty of uncertainly over who is available for next season, who is contracted and if any new people have been signed. By my calculations, of the 32 from last year that are listed on the BOPRU website :-
      13 are playing in Super Rugby or are contracted to The NZ 7,s
      6 are playing locally
      6 are overseas
      2 are gone
      5 are unaccounted for.

      Can anyone shed anymore light on things ?
